Undergraduate Tuition & Fees

The following table compares 2023-2024 undergraduate tuition & fees between selected colleges. The average undergraduate tuition & fees is $30,109 for all students. The 2023-2024 undergraduate tuition & fees of selected colleges are increased by 3.32% compared to the previous year.
Among the selected colleges, California Institute of the Arts requires the most expensive tuition & fees of $56,724 and World Mission University has the lowest tuition & fees of $6,920 for undergraduate programs.

Graduate Tuition & Fees

The following table compares 2023-2024 graduate tuition & fees between selected colleges. The average graduate tuition & fees is $18,430 for all students. The 2023-2024 graduate tuition & fees of selected colleges are decreased by -15.54% compared to the previous year.
Among the selected colleges, California Institute of the Arts requires the most expensive graduate tuition & fees of $41,140 and World Mission University has the lowest graduate tuition & fees of $5,400.
